I was very exited to play this game, as I am an art historian who regularly engages in translating texts that are hundreds of years old. The translation aspect of the game is unique, and an approach I hope is incorporated into games in the future. That said, the fun of translation is outweighed by other less than stellar aspects. Movement between locations occurs through an interesting mechanism, but is often tedious and time consuming (not to mention hard to control). There is no fast travel, and most locations cannot be visited more than once. In addition, the dialogue between characters is extremely hostile, and the player is rarely given any option to engage in dialogue that isn't insulting. Worst of all, the many enticing mysteries presented by the translations and artifacts are never fully resolved. Even after finishing the game, there are few answers, and it feels as though a suspenseful buildup led to nothing. I know many people play this game multiple times, but the clunky movement and unpleasant dialogue makes that idea unappealing to me personally.

Just completed this game. I am new to video games, but have played a few RPGs before (Thronebreaker, Disco Elysium, Operencia, Kingdom Come Deliverance, Pyre). This game is by far the best of those I've played. Specifically, I enjoy the turn based combat (although usually combat is not for me), and the visuals are really pleasant and varied by area of the game. It is easy to spend hours playing this game, or pick it up for a few quick minutes of play. The looting (which I always like) is a big part of the game, and some of the abilities given to you throughout the game are really unique. I also enjoy the different capabilities of each race in the game. The biggest issue I have with this game is the super awkward flirtations between characters that serves no purpose in the story. Every companion wants to jump my bones (literally) and it just isnt believable at all. I understand this is common in certain games, but I found it distracting during dialogue. Also the plot towards the end gets a little weird and seems no terribly well thought out. Considering how excellent so many aspects of this game are, it is strange that the plot is a weaker point. I liked how many characters I could interact with in the story, but didn't like how many conversations with animals lead to "mercy" killings. Though the visuals are not super graphic, there are definitely some mature themes that make this game unsuitable for children. Red Prince is the best character by far in terms of dialogue, story, and development. Lohse is the weakest story-wise. I strongly recommend ditching Lohse and having Red Prince on your team. Even though there are some flaws in this game, they are entirely outweighed by the visuals, dynamic environments and exploration. Buy this game. Play this game. You will have a good time, or at least become Red Prince's slave.
